President Donald Trump signed the bill requiring the Justice Department to release unclassified documents related to late sex offender Jeffrey Epstein within 30 days, although the law makes some exceptions when it comes to victim’s privacy. The Attorney General can also withhold certain information that would jeopardize an ongoing investigation — which includes the one the president just ordered to look into what he says are Democrats’ connections to Epstein.
